预涂感光版制造工艺流程

    The manufacturing process of pre-coated lithographic plates involves several steps to ensure the production of high-quality plates. Here is a detailed explanation of the process:
    1. Plate Preparation: The first step is to prepare the base material for the lithographic plate. This usually involves cleaning the plate surface to remove any dirt or contaminants. It is essential to have a clean surface to ensure proper adhesion of the coating.
    2. Coating Application: In this step, a photosensitive coating is applied to the plate surface. The coating contains light-sensitive compounds that react when exposed to UV light. The coating can be applied using various methods, such as roller coating or spray coating. The thickness of the coating layer is carefully controlled to ensure optimal performance.

    4. Exposure: Once the coating is dry, the plate is exposed to UV light through a mask or a film negative. The light-sensitive compounds in the coating react to the UV light and undergo a chemical change. This change creates an image on the plate, which will later be transferred onto the printing surface.
    5. Development: After exposure, the plate goes through a development process. This involves removing the unexposed areas of the coating. The development is typically done using a solvent or a developer solution. The exposed areas of the coating remain on the plate, forming the image.
    6. Post-Treatment: After development, the plate may undergo additional post-treatment processes to enhance its durability and performance. This can include baking the plate to increase its hardness or applying a protective layer to prevent scratches or damage during printing.
    7. Quality Control: Throughout the manufacturing process, quality control checks are performed to ensure that the plates meet the required specifications. This can involve checking the coating thickness, image quality, and overall plate integrity.

    预涂感光版的制造工艺流程涉及多个步骤,以确保生产出高质量的版材。下面是对这个过程的详细解释:
    1. 版材准备,第一步是准备感光版的基材。这通常包括清洁版面,以去除任何污垢或杂质。确保表面干净是为了确保涂层的良好附着性。
    2. 涂层施加,在这一步中,将感光涂层涂布在版面上。涂层中含有对紫外线敏感的化合物。可以使用不同的方法来涂布涂层,如滚涂或喷涂。涂层的厚度需要精确控制,以确保最佳性能。
    3. 干燥,涂层施加后,版材经过干燥过程。可以通过自然风干或通过干燥炉使版材通过干燥。在进行下一步之前,确保涂层完全干燥是非常重要的。
    4. 曝光,涂层干燥后,版材通过遮罩或底片进行紫外线曝光。涂层中的光敏化合物对紫外线光线反应,并发生化学变化。这种变化在版材上形成图像,稍后将转移到印刷表面上。
    5. 显影,曝光后,版材经过显影过程。这涉及去除涂层中未曝光的区域。通常使用溶剂或显影液进行显影。涂层中曝光的区域保留在版材上,形成图像。
    6. 后处理,显影后,版材可能需要经过附加的后处理过程,以增强其耐用性和性能。这可以包括烘烤版材以增加硬度,或者涂布保护层以防止印刷过程中的刮擦或损坏。
    7. 质量控制,在整个制造过程中,进行质量控制检查,以确保版材符合所需规格。这可以涉及检查涂层厚度、图像质量和整体版材完整性。
